Abstract
The treatment effect of wetland simulation system to domestic wastewater was investigated in vertical flow wetland(VFW) artificial wetland simulation system of Hunnan in Shenyang.The influences of the different hydraulic loadings were analyzed.The results indicate that the treatment effect of VFW simulation system to domestic wastewater is better.NH+4—N contents,TP contents,CODCr contents and BOD5 contents of effluent reach band-A in discharge standard of pollutants for municipal wastewater treatment plant(GB18918—2002).The optimal hydraulic loading of VFW simulation system is 0.156 t/m2·d.
